Romania - Pillar I

The project will address qualification needs for the construction sector as a first step in order to support the development of a national strategy for Romania, including recommendations for the certification, qualification or training of craftsmen involved in energy efficiency and installers of RES systems in buildings. The project will also analyse the need to adapt the existing professional and university training curricula to reflect the new qualification needs. The intended approach is to gather in a common platform all relevant stakeholders, inbuilding and training sectors in Romania, and to work together in a consultation process with a view to define a coherent strategy and roadmap to embed training on intelligent energy solutions for buildings in the mainstream curricula and practice of building professionals, taking into account the expected contribution of the building sector to the national 2020 targets and the requirements for nearly zero-energy buildings. Based on the active involvement of the key actors, it is envisaged that the final national roadmap is endorsed by relevant authorities and stakeholders with a commitment to carry out and implement the proposed strategy

QualiShell - Pillar II

The BUILD UP Skills QualiShell project represents a natural continuation of BUILD UP Skills Romania (ROBUST) project and supports the development and implementation of large scale and long lasting national qualification schemes for the installers of external thermal insulating composite systems and high efficiency windows systems (carpentry and insulating glazing). The aim of the project is to ensure not only a high quality installation of very efficient building envelope components, but also the achievement of high performance building envelopes by developing effective tools to embed the adequate knowledge and skills in the relevant occupations and to foster the evolution in the national qualification system and in the vision of key stakeholders in the construction sector, moving towards the actual implementation of nearly zero energy buildings in Romania.

Objectives

To activate the relevant stakeholders in the National Qualification Platform and to use an extended National Consultation Committee to validate. implement and monitor the proposed qualification schemes;To substantiate the development of the qualification schemes for building envelope insulators and window system fitters by realising a thorough occupational analysis to detail the National Qualification Framework, by exploring internal and external resources for training and qualification in the construction sector and by defining an adequate procedural framework;To develop and validate two national qualification schemes for building envelope insulators and window system fitters, by defining and improving the training courses curricula, content and evaluation tools;To raise awareness and to ensure an effective communication process between different major stakeholders as well as to develop effective mechanisms to support a large scale implementation of the developed schemes until 2020 and beyond.
